Hace 589 días
28

Usando Apt-Pinning en Debian

He vuelto a Debian Squeeze. El motivo que me impulsó a regresar a la rama estable de Debian, (ya que siempre he usado Testing) ha sido la incorrecta visualización de la tipografía usando un kernel superior a la versión 2.6.32-5-686.

El problema principal de dar este paso, es que pierdo muchos paquetes que están en los repositorios de Debian Testing y que Debian Stable no tiene. Ejemplo de ellos son LibreOffice 3.4.3 y Turpial.

Por suerte, en Debian existe una opción para Apt llamado Apt-Pinning y usted se preguntará ¿Para que sirve eso? Pues bien, sin entrar en la muela técnica, con Apt-Pinning puedo usar Debian Squeeze y al mismo tiempo, paquetes de Debian Wheezy. ¿Genial cierto?

¿Cómo lo hago?

Después de instalar Debian Squeeze y configurarlo, actualizarlo y demás, lo primero que hago es añadir los repositorios de Testing, por lo que el fichero /etc/apt/sources.list me queda de esta forma:

# Repositorios Stable
deb http://ftp.debian.org/debian squeeze main contrib non-free
# Repositorios Testing
deb http://ftp.debian.org/debian wheezy main contrib non-free

Posteriormente creo el fichero /etc/apt/preferences y le pongo esto adentro:

Package: *
Pin: release n=stable
Pin-Priority: 900

Package: *
Pin: release n=testing
Pin-Priority: 800

Ahora abro un terminal actualizo los repositorios.

$ sudo apt-get update

Ahora cuando quiero instalar Turpial por ejemplo, tengo dos formas de hacerlo en el terminal:

$ sudo apt-get install turpial/testing
$ sudo apt-get -t testing install turpial

Y APT se encarga de escoger solamente las dependencias necesarias de un repositorio y del otro. Si quieren obtener más información sobre esto, pueden visitar este enlace.

COMENTARIOS PARA EL AUTOR

elav

elav: Melómano, informático, amante de GNU/Linux, el Software Libre y la Tecnología en general. Blogger y Diseñador por hobby. Usuario de GNU/Linux #468707 | Debian Testing | http://elav.desdelinux.net

  1. lector
    • autor
      • lector
        • KZKG^Gaara admin
      • msx lector
        • KZKG^Gaara admin
          • Lex.RC1 usuario
          • KZKG^Gaara admin
          • Lex.RC1 usuario
          • elav autor
          • KZKG^Gaara admin
  2. lector
    • KZKG^Gaara admin
      • lector
        • lector
  3. lector
    • lector
  4. lector
    • KZKG^Gaara admin
      • lector
      • lector
    • autor
  5. lector
    • autor
      • lector
  6. lector
    • autor

Dejar tu comentario

Tu dirección de correo electrónico no será publicado.

Puedes usar las siguientes etiquetas y atributos HTML: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>